A Glimpse into Talk Disability: Invisible Disabilities

Dive into the captivating narratives of individuals grappling with invisible disabilities in the series Talk Disability: Invisible Disabilities. Comprising five concise episodes, each spanning around five minutes, this thought-provoking series fosters open and authentic conversations about a myriad of conditions, including stammering, bipolar disorder, autism, ADHD, and more. By courageously sharing their journeys, the participants aspire to empower others and foster a society that embraces diversity and promotes inclusivity.

Episode NoRelease DateTitleSummary
1March 8, 2023JessieJessie Yendle, a passionate champion for individuals with stammers, gained prominence through a viral video that showcased her remarkable courage and determination. Now an ambassador, she dedicates herself to raising awareness and educating others about the challenges faced by people with stammering.
2March 30, 2023ChrisChris McEwen has experienced a life of extraordinary juxtapositions — stepping into the boxing ring, serving in the army, and battling profound depression. Today, he dedicates himself to empowering children with disabilities by teaching them the transformative art of boxing, fostering self-expression and personal development.
3April 2, 2023SelenaSelena Caemawr’s journey towards self-acceptance was fraught with the struggle of feeling like an outsider, until receiving an autism diagnosis later in life shed light on her unique perspective. Driven to make a positive impact, she established a welcoming café where autistic individuals can find solace and be embraced, drawing on her own challenges in various employment settings.
4July 9, 2023OliviaOlivia Breen, a true inspiration, defied the limitations of cerebral palsy and partial deafness since birth. Through unwavering determination and exceptional talent in track and field, she achieved multiple World Champion titles and the prestigious role of Team Captain for Wales in the Commonwealth Games, embodying the power of resilience and triumph.
5T.B.A.CocoCoco’s life took an unforeseen twist with an ADHD diagnosis, triggering a transformational journey towards their true calling. Now, driven by an unwavering passion to assist others, Coco devotes themselves to supporting individuals facing similar challenges, empowering them to embrace their unique strengths and unlock their fullest potential.

What are invisible disabilities?

Invisible disabilities are conditions or impairments that are not immediately apparent or visible to others. They can include mental health conditions, chronic pain, autoimmune disorders, neurological conditions, and more. While these disabilities may not be physically apparent, they can still significantly impact a person’s life and functioning.
